Illustration 1 g01080717
Schematic for auxiliary temperature sensorTest Step 1. Inspect Electrical Connectors and Wiring
Place the engine control in the OFF/RESET mode.
Thoroughly inspect the J1/P1 ECM connector, the customer connector, and the sensor connector that is in the circuit. Refer to Troubleshooting, "Electrical Connectors - Inspect" for details.
Perform a 45 N (10 lb) pull test on each of the wires in the ECM connector, in the customer connector, and in the sensor connector that is associated with the auxiliary temperature sensor circuit.
Check the ECM Connector (allen head screw) for the proper torque. Refer to Troubleshooting, "Electrical Connectors - Inspect" for details.
Check the customer connector (allen head screw) for the proper torque. Refer to Troubleshooting, "Electrical Connectors - Inspect" for details.Expected Result:All connectors, pins, and sockets are completely coupled and/or inserted, and the harness and wiring are free of corrosion, of abrasion and of pinch points.Results:
OK - The connectors and wiring are OK. Proceed to Test Step 2.
Not OK - There is a problem in the connectors and/or wiring.Repair: Repair the wiring and connectors or replace the wiring or the connectors. Ensure that all of the seals are properly connected. Verify that the repair eliminates the problem.Verify that the repair eliminates the problem.STOPTest Step 2. Check the Sensor Supply Voltage at the Sensor Connector
Disconnect the suspect sensor.
Place the engine control in the ON mode.
Use a multimeter to measure the voltage across terminal A (+8V Digital) and terminal B (Digital Return) at the harness side of the connector for the auxiliary temperature sensor.
Place the engine control in the OFF/RESET mode.Expected Result:The digital sensor supply voltage is 8.0 0.4 VDC.Results:
OK - The supply voltage is reaching the sensor. Proceed to Test Step 3.
Not OK - The digital sensor supply voltage is not reaching the sensor.Repair: Refer to Troubleshooting, "Digital Sensor Supply Circuit - Test" for the appropriate troubleshooting procedure.STOPTest Step 3. Check for Opens in the Wiring
Illustration 2 g00806454
P1/J1 schematic
Illustration 3 g00806473
P61/J61 Schematic
Disconnect the following connectors.
P142/J142 (auxiliary temperature sensor)
J1/P1 (ECM connector)
J61/P61 (customer connector)
Measure the resistance between the following terminals.
P1-4 to J61-8
P1-5 to J61-9
P1-68 to J61-11
P61-8 to P142-A
P61-9 to P142-B
P61-11 to P142-CExpected Result:The resistance through the signal wire is less than 5 Ohms.Results:
OK - The resistance through the signal wire is less than 5 Ohms. Proceed to Test Step 4.
Not OK - The resistance through the signal wire is more than 5 Ohms. There is an open circuit or excessive resistance in the signal circuit of the harness.Repair: Repair the circuit.Verify that the repair eliminates the problem.STOPTest Step 4. Check for Shorts in the Wiring
Reconnect the customer connector J61/P61.
Check the resistance between the following terminals of ECM connector P1 and every pin in ECM connector P1. Check the resistance between the following terminals of ECM connector P1 and every pin on ECM connector P1.
P1-4
P1-5
P1-68Expected Result:The resistance is greater than 20,000 Ohms for each measurement.Results:
